The Evolution of Football Betting

Traditionally, football betting was conducted through bookmakers, often requiring people to visit physical shops to place their bets. With the rise of the internet, the industry underwent a dramatic transformation. Online betting platforms emerged, making it possible for fans across the world to participate at any time. Today, mobile apps and digital wallets have made football betting accessible with just a few taps, creating a seamless and convenient experience.

This digital revolution has not only increased accessibility but also broadened the range of betting markets. Beyond simple win-or-lose wagers, bettors can now choose from options like total goals, half-time results, exact scorelines, and even in-play betting where decisions are made as the match unfolds.

The Role of Strategy in Football Betting

Although football betting involves an element of chance, strategy plays an equally important role. Successful bettors rarely rely on pure luck. Instead, they analyze team performance, player statistics, head-to-head records, and even weather conditions before making a decision. Understanding football deeply and keeping up with current news, such as injuries or tactical changes, often provides an advantage.

Some bettors adopt disciplined strategies, such as only wagering a fixed percentage of their bankroll or avoiding emotional decisions when their favorite team is involved. Others use statistical models or follow expert tipsters who analyze games professionally. Whatever the approach, a strong strategy increases the likelihood of consistent outcomes over time.

The Psychological Side of Football Betting

The excitement of football betting is closely tied to human psychology. The anticipation of winning creates adrenaline, while the possibility of loss generates risk and tension. For many, this combination produces an enjoyable form of entertainment. However, it can also lead to impulsive decisions if not managed responsibly.

Psychologists point out that betting can become problematic when individuals chase losses or begin to rely on it as a source of income rather than entertainment. This is why responsible betting practices, such as setting limits and knowing when to stop, are crucial for maintaining balance.

Football Betting and Technology

Technology has been the driving force behind the rapid growth of football betting. Artificial intelligence and machine learning now play significant roles in analyzing games and predicting outcomes. Some platforms offer predictive tools that help bettors make informed decisions, while others use AI to detect unusual betting patterns and maintain fair play.

Live streaming integration has also enhanced the betting experience. Fans can watch matches directly on betting platforms and place wagers in real time. This immediacy has made in-play betting particularly popular, as fans respond to the flow of the game with quick decisions.

The importance of Responsible Football Betting

While football betting offers entertainment and excitement, it is essential to approach it responsibly. Setting personal limits, avoiding impulsive decisions, and treating betting as a form of leisure rather than income are vital practices. Many betting platforms now include tools that allow users to self-exclude, set deposit limits, or seek support if they feel their betting habits are becoming problematic.

Responsible betting ensures that the enjoyment of football remains intact and that individuals do not experience the negative consequences of gambling addiction. Governments and organizations worldwide continue to emphasize education and awareness campaigns to promote safe betting environments.
